Product Identification

Product Name

Sudan Red

Synonyms

1-[(4-Phenyldiazenylphenyl)hydrazinylidene]naphthalen-2-one
Sudan III

CAS

85-86-9

Formula

C22H16N4O

Molecular Weight

352.4

EINECS

201-638-4

RTECS

QK4250000

RTECS Class

Tumorigen; Mutagen

Merck

12,9054

Beilstein/Gmelin

931185

Beilstein Reference

4-16-00-00248

More
Less

Physical and Chemical Properties

Appearance

Red powder.

Solubility in water

Insoluble

Melting Point

205.3 - 206.3

pKa/pKb

7.51

Usage

Dye.

First Aid Measures

Ingestion

If victim is conscious and alert, give 2-4 cupfuls of milk or water. Never give anything by mouth to an unconscious person. Get medical aid immediately.

Inhalation

Remove from exposure to fresh air immediately. If not breathing, give artificial respiration. If breathing is difficult, give oxygen. Get medical aid.

Skin

Get medical aid. Immediately flush skin with plenty of soap and water for at least 15 minutes while removing contaminated clothing and shoes.

Eyes

Immediately flush eyes with plenty of water for at least 15 minutes, occasionally lifting the upper and lower eyelids. Get medical aid immediately.

More
Less

Handling and Storage

Storage

Store in a tightly closed container. Store in a cool, dry, well-ventilated area away from incompatible substances.

Handling

Wash thoroughly after handling. Use with adequate ventilation. Minimize dust generation and accumulation. Avoid contact with skin and eyes. Keep container tightly closed. Avoid ingestion and inhalation.

Hazards Identification

Ingestion

The toxicological properties of this substance have not been fully investigated.

Inhalation

Dust is irritating to the respiratory tract. The toxicological properties of this substance have not been fully investigated.

Skin

No information regarding skin irritation and other potential effects was found.

Eyes

No information regarding eye irritation and other potential effects was found.

Exposure Controls/Personal Protection

Personal Protection

Eyes: Wear appropriate protective eyeglasses or chemical safety goggles as described by OSHA's eye and face protection regulations in 29 CFR 1910.133 or European Standard EN166. Skin: Wear appropriate protective gloves to prevent skin exposure. Clothing: Wear appropriate protective clothing to prevent skin exposure.

Respirators

Follow the OSHA respirator regulations found in 29CFR 1910.134 or European Standard EN 149. Always use a NIOSH or European Standard EN 149 approved respirator when necessary.

Fire Fighting Measures

Fire Fighting

Wear a self-contained breathing apparatus in pressure-demand, MSHA/NIOSH (approved or equivalent), and full protective gear. Combustion generates toxic fumes. Extinguishing media: For small fires, use water spray, dry chemical, carbon dioxide or chemical foam.

More
Less

Accidental Release Measures

Small spills/leaks

Sweep up, then place into a suitable container for disposal. Avoid generating dusty conditions.

More
Less

Stability and Reactivity

Stability

Materials containing similar functional groups can decompose at elevated temperatures.

Incompatibilities

Strong oxidizers.

Decomposition

Nitrogen oxides, carbon monoxide, carbon dioxide.
